Lead Water Line Replacement Project Update
In the last month New London ― Federal, state and local officials gathered in regards to $7 million in federal dollars to help the lead water line replacement project of the dangerous material in pipes buried throughout the City of New London, Connecticut.

 
This was part of President Biden's Bipartisan Infrastructure funding that will help replace around 150 lead service lines while completing ongoing inspection of homes and water lines from the streets.

Gold Star Memorial Bridge Lane Closures
An announcement from the CT Department of Transportation:
 
CTDOT is announcing right lane closures on I-95 Northbound Gold Star Memorial Bridge in New London and Groton starting Monday, September 9, 2024.
The Connecticut Department of Transportation (CTDOT) is announcing right lane closures on I-95 Northbound Gold Star Memorial Bridge in New London and Groton. This project is scheduled to occur on Monday, September 9, 2024.
 
The rehabilitation project consists of strengthening the truss approach spans of the Gold Star Memorial Bridge. The work requires the closing of a right or left shoulder and adjacent lane while activities are proceeding below the deck surface on the truss sections of the bridge. This work began February 28, 2022, with an anticipated completion date of June 25, 2025.

Maritime Heritage Festival
Celebrate Connecticut’s rich maritime history and our connection to the sea!
 
This fun-filled weekend has Military and Private Ships, Flock Theatre’s Burning of Benedict Arnold, Little Mermaids and Sea Monsters Parade, Coast Guard Helicopter Search and Rescue Demonstration, Sea Service Showdown – a Maritime Skills Challenge, Fishing Clinic, Kids Nautical Zone, Rum Tasting, Live Music, Local Vendors, Food Trucks, and more!
 
New this year is the joining of the Basque Festival on Saturday for a full weekend of nautical fun!
 
 
We Are New London Parade
Mark your calendar:

 
We Are New London's official Parade is on Sunday, September 22, 2024!
 
The parade will start at 2 p.m., beginning at State and Washington Streets and concluding at The Whale Tail.
Come together to celebrate the vibrant diversity that makes New London so special! This is an opportunity for all New Londoners to showcase their unique cultures, traditions, and love for our city.
